The journey begins long before you request a quote. Comprehensive internal preparation is the non-negotiable foundation. Start by developing a complete Product Design (CAD model, preferably in STEP or IGS format) and a detailed Product Requirements Document. This document should specify the plastic material, intended annual volumes, cosmetic requirements (texture, polish), critical tolerances, and the type of injection molding machine you plan to use. Furthermore, decide on your mold standards: Will you require a DME or HASCO standard mold base, or is a local Chinese standard acceptable? This clarity prevents costly misunderstandings and allows the China mold factory to provide an accurate and comparable quotation. A professional Data Package signals to suppliers that you are a serious and knowledgeable buyer, setting the stage for a more collaborative partnership.

With your package ready, supplier verification becomes your most critical task. Casting a wide net on B2B platforms is a start, but 2026 procurement demands deeper due diligence. Prioritize manufacturers with demonstrable expertise in your specific industry, whether automotive, medical, consumer electronics, or packaging. Scrutinize their portfolio for projects of similar complexity. The essential step is a virtual or, ideally, in-person factory audit. Request a live video tour of their facility; observe their machinery (EDM, CNC, CMM), workshop organization, and engineering team. Verify certifications like ISO 9001, but more importantly, assess their process control. Ask for and contact references from their existing overseas clients. This phase is about moving from a list of potential vendors to a shortlist of verified partners capable of executing your vision for how to make custom plastic molds.

Technical alignment and commercial clarity in the contracting phase safeguard your investment. The quotation from your chosen injection mold supplier should be dissected. Ensure it includes a full breakdown: mold base material and hardness, core/cavity steel grade (e.g., S136, 718H), lifetime expectancy (number of shots), number of cavities, hot runner system brand (if applicable), and a detailed payment schedule linked to milestones. The contract must explicitly outline all critical factors: approved CAD version, inspection criteria (what CMM reports will be provided), approval process for T1 samples, warranty period for mold repair or modification, and protocols for handling design changes. Clearly define the stages for payments—typically 30-50% deposit, 40% after first article approval, and the balance before shipment. This legal and technical framework eliminates ambiguity.

Proactive quality control, integrated throughout the build process, is what separates successful imports from problematic ones. Do not adopt a “black box” approach where you simply wait for the finished mold. Instead, require regular progress updates with photos and videos at key stages: material procurement, machining of the mold base, EDM/texturing, and assembly. The most critical point is the First Article Inspection (FAI). Plan to receive and test the initial T1 samples from the mold at your facility or a trusted third-party lab. Evaluate the parts for dimensional accuracy, cosmetic defects, and assembly fit. Provide clear, documented feedback. A reputable China mold factory will expect this and budget for minor revisions. This iterative feedback loop, managed through clear communication tools like shared spreadsheets or project management software, ensures the final deliverable meets your specifications.

The final phase encompasses logistics, knowledge transfer, and long-term partnership. Once the mold is approved, decide on shipping terms (FOB, EXW, CIF) with your supplier. Ensure the mold is properly preserved with anti-rust agents and securely packed in a custom wooden crate. All documentation—final 2D drawings, maintenance manuals, and CMM reports—should be received digitally and physically. For ongoing production, discuss the terms for mold storage and maintenance at the factory if you plan for continuous production in China. Establishing a clear communication channel for future production runs or minor repairs turns a one-time transaction into a strategic manufacturing partnership.
